Dr. Harold "Hal" Goldman, 94, died peacefully in his sleep on March 13th, at Zarrow Pointe, in Tulsa, Oklahoma. Hal was born on April 2nd, 1928, in Boston, Massachusetts. Following his graduation from Tufts medical school in 1954 and his marriage to wife, Shirley, they moved to Tulsa in 1958. There they started a family, and Hall was involved in forming a thriving pediatric practice.
He was admired by his many patients and their families. Later in his life, Hal practiced neurology throughout the region, retiring at the age of 90, as one of the most senior practicing physicians in the state of Oklahoma.
Hal loved his family and the relationships he built while running, playing tennis, and the lively conversations he engaged in with his friends.
